Argentina sought independence from Spain primarily due to a desire for self-governance and the influence of Enlightenment ideas promoting liberty and equality. The economic restrictions imposed by Spanish colonial rule stifled local trade and development, leading to growing discontent among the criollo (local-born) population. Additionally, the weakening of Spanish authority during the Napoleonic Wars provided an opportunity for revolutionary movements to gain momentum, ultimately culminating in Argentina's Declaration of Independence in 1816.
